基于四行精密播种的玉米直播机设计与试验

【摘要】 为了解决播种玉米种子精度低的问题,设计了一款基于四行精密播种的玉米直播机,可实现玉米种子快速、精准播种。试验表明:该玉米直播机移动性能好、播种速度快、种植深度和每穴种子数量更加准确,封土情况也大幅改善,符合设计需求,具有较高的可靠性和可行性。

【Abstract】 In order to solve the problem that it is difficult for farmers to sow corn seeds, it designs a corn direct seeding machine based on four rows of precision sowing, which can realize the rapid and accurate sowing of corn seeds. The test shows that the corn direct seeding machine has good moving performance, fast sowing speed, more accurate planting depth and the number of seeds per hole, and the soil sealing condition is also greatly improved, indicating that the corn direct seeding machine meets the design requirements, which has high reliability and feasibility.
